Share Icons Properties Properties New York NY The Shops at Columbus Circle Mixed-Use City Centers Contact Information Website 10 Columbus Circle, New York, NY, 10019 The Numbers Floors 80 Square Footage 2.8m Completion 2004 The Shops at Columbus Circle has served as the gateway to Central Park and Manhattan’s Upper West Side for more than 20 years. This iconic lifestyle and cultural destination is home to some of New York City’s most beloved chef-driven dining destinations, including Per Se and Masa, both 3 Michelin-starred restaurants, as well as beloved concepts from Momofuku and Quality Branded; an array of fashion and lifestyle retailers; and public art icons “Adam and Eve” by renowned Artist Fernando Botero. The Shops and Restaurant and Bar Collection are the heart of Deutsche Bank Center which includes the celebrated performing arts space Jazz at Lincoln Center; the five-star Mandarin Oriental New York Hotel; state-of-the-art commercial offices; luxury residences offering unparalleled views; and more.
